Transaction 206a1525860d1b7198c67c2d175c8f92417a8e6ca6b78c99738a2332e63b665d

block
8259b5d5a29e9ba48708155f97791e4e321279890f247bd34f4b20baa0981fee

1 Input

23 Outputs